Initialize array of classes c++
Webb5 dec. 2024 · One way to initialize a set is to copy contents from another set one after another by using the copy constructor. Syntax: setNew_set (old_set); Here, old_set is the set from which contents will be copied into the New_set Below is the C++ program to implement the above approach: C++ #include #include using … WebbFör 1 dag sedan · So, if you simply make the array const instead of constexpr and then use the same lambda initializer in an out-of-class definition, then it will be initialized at …
Initialize array of classes c++
Did you know?
WebbInitialization. Initialization of a variable provides its initial value at the time of construction. The initial value may be provided in the initializer section of a declarator or a new expression. It also takes place during function calls: function parameters and the function return values are also initialized. WebbIn the specific case when the array is a data member of the class you can't initialize it in the current version of the language. There's no syntax for that. Either provide a …
WebbThe possibly constrained (since C++20) auto specifier can be used as array element type in the declaration of a pointer or reference to array, which deduces the element type from the initializer or the function argument (since C++14), e.g. auto (*p)[42] = &a; is valid if a is an lvalue of type int[42] . (since C++11) WebbDefault initialization depends on the storage class specifier, described above. ... Structures, unions and arrays can be initialized in their declarations using an initializer list. Unless designators are used, ... but the draft C++ standard uses main()). The return value of main ...
WebbRobert is an Electronics Engineer skilled in developing software, embedded firmware, and hardware. His work is found in a broad range … Webbför 20 timmar sedan · I've been writing abstract classes for my OpenGL code in C++, and it all works fine except the VBO class. After some experimenting I figured out that the …
WebbI am having trouble creating a dynamic array of class objects inside a class in C++. The concept is: assume we have a class A. In this class, I want to have an array of objects …
Webb我正在嘗試創建一個名為Player的類,該類具有一個稱為scores的數組,該數組在Player類的屬性中聲明為大小。 但是,當我初始化一個新播放器時,sizeof scores 方法會給我 ,並且實際上會初始化一個大小為 而不是 的分數數組。我想知道為什么以及如何解決這個問題。 each teams odds to win super bowlWebb23 juni 2024 · An array of pointers is an array of pointer variables.It is also known as pointer arrays. We will discuss how to create a 1D and 2D array of pointers dynamically. The word dynamic signifies that the memory is allocated during the runtime, and it allocates memory in Heap Section.In a Stack, memory is limited but is depending upon which … each tenant is jointly and severally liableWebb25 juli 2012 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ams each ten yearsWebbExplain what is a 1D or single dimensional array with syntax Declaration and Initialization in Hindi. Arrays: Single Dimensional Array: Declaration, Initialization and Accessing Elements #arrays #singledimensional #typesofarrays Arrays are Homogeneous. Declaring and Initializing Single Dimensional Arrays We know how to … each tells how to make a specific proteinWebbArray of objects initialization with constructors in C++ Here, we will learn how to initialize array of objects using constructors in C++? In this program, we will define a class and declare array of objects, declare object (array of objects) will be initialized through the constructor. csharp await foreachWebb1 maj 2014 · You can get around this in C++ with constructor initialization list. By changing cStudent's constructor to cStudent (int age) : studentAge (age), shouldBeGraduated ( (age>18)? true : false) {} You can initialize the two variables with a value instead of creating them and then assigning a value. If you don't recognize … each teams draft gradeWebbTwo standard-layout non-union class types are called layout-compatible if they are the same type ignoring cv-qualifiers, if any, are layout-compatible enumerations (i.e. enumerations with the same underlying type), or if their common initial sequence consists of every non-static data member and bit-field (in the example above, A and B are … csharp await multiple tasks